  25 /*
  26  * @test
  27  * @summary Test JVM's awareness of cpu sets (cpus and mems)
  28  * @library /testlibrary /testlibrary/whitebox
  29  * @build AttemptOOM CPUSetsReader sun.hotspot.WhiteBox PrintContainerInfo
  30  * @run driver ClassFileInstaller -jar whitebox.jar sun.hotspot.WhiteBox sun.hotspot.WhiteBox$WhiteBoxPermission
  31  * @run driver TestCPUSets
  32  */
